AI Incubator

±¬ÁϹÏ's new AI Incubator provides researchers with access to Vertex AI for training and deploying models, and AgentSpace for building and testing intelligent agents, enabling applied AI research across disciplines.

Faculty have access to a suite of AI research tools ¾±²Ô³¦±ô³Ü»å¾±²Ô²µâ€¯NotebookLM for literature synthesis,  GrantAI for proposal support, and AlphaFold for protein structure prediction. These tools are all designed to streamline research workflows and expand AI adoption.

Cloud-Based Research

A robust cloud-based research ecosystem supports high-performance computing (HPC), HIPAA-aligned Cloud Folders, BigQuery, Earth Engine, and simulation environments through Google Cloud Platform (GCP) and AWS, offering scalable and secure infrastructure for interdisciplinary research. Application access supports medical data integration, enabling AI-assisted medical analytics, clinical outcomes studies, and population health research.

Training and Credentialing

  • Onboarding pathways have been created to provide training, credentialing, and guided access to cloud platforms, AI environments, and secure data systems.
  • GeoSEA and immersive labs support simulation-based, spatially-rich studies in geospatial, coastal, and environmental domains, leveraging XR tools and Earth Engine for visualization and analysis.
  • New research enablement zones and collaborative digital spaces support interdisciplinary research, innovation pipelines, and faculty-led partnerships.
